The first two movies in the sci-fi epic series, Avatar, explore the Na'vi humanoid species on the planet of Pandora as they face the threat of colonization. The movies are known for their gorgeous visual effects and world-building.

Before Disney and their subsidiary 20th Century Studios even knew the second film would find success at the box office, though, they confirmed Avatar 3, 4, and 5. The production company created Avatar 3 alongside The Way of Water, and it has mostly completed filming as of the time of writing. James Cameron provided little tidbits about the upcoming sequels during an interview with the French news site 20 Minutes.

Both Avatar and The Way of Water look at the gray area, rather than depicting the world as black and white. Jake Sully, a man who worked for the corrupt humans, defected to the Na'vi because he wanted to do the right thing. The antagonists get moments of sympathy that humanize them to audiences. The movies also establish that not everyone within the existing Na'vi community agrees on the right way to handle things, with some good characters making bad choices.
